Inter defender Juan Jesus believes that the team deserve
to be in first place in the league standings and revealed that he won’t settle
for less.
The Nerazzurri are currently in fourth place on the Serie
A table, only two points away from breaking into the top three, but the
22-year-old admits that he won’t be satisfied with just a Champions League
spot.
Juan Jesus spoke to Sky Sport Italia about his hunger for
success, while also praising his fellow Biscione team-mates and coach Walter
Mazzarri.
“I wouldn’t take third, but I’d take first,” said the
Brazilian. “That’s because Inter deserve to always be in first place.
“I trust my team, we’re all doing our jobs, each and
every one of us. We need to take things one match at a time and see where we
are come the end.
“We also have an intelligent coach. He understands
Italian football well, he also looks at us as individuals and speaks to each of
us.
“He’s a great coach and he will be for a long time to
come. He’s doing well because he’s helping the team and the team will help
him.”
